Role Summary
The Assistant Project Manager position is a full-time, on-site opportunity in Nanuet, NY. In this role, you will support Project Managers with day-to-day coordination, schedule monitoring, and delivery of milestones, inspections, and project outputs. The position also includes handling material and equipment follow-ups, vendor coordination, and logistics support tied to project execution.
Core Duties
You will help keep projects moving by maintaining documentation, preparing progress updates, assisting with inspections and quality reviews, and sharing status information with both internal teams and outside partners. The role also involves identifying issues early, working toward practical resolutions, keeping records well organized, and helping ensure compliance with safety, regulatory, and company requirements.
Qualifications
The ideal candidate should bring a solid base in project coordination, including scheduling, task follow-through, documentation, and managing communication across several stakeholders. Familiarity with expediting work, such as monitoring orders, tracking deliveries, and addressing delays, is important. A working knowledge of inspection support, logistics coordination, and material flow is also expected.
Strong organization and time-management abilities are needed to handle shifting priorities in a fast-paced environment. Clear written and verbal communication skills are essential for interacting professionally with clients, vendors, and internal colleagues. Candidates should be comfortable using office and project-tracking software, including spreadsheets and standard productivity tools.
An associate’s or bachelor’s degree in Construction Management, Engineering, Business, or a related discipline is preferred, though equivalent relevant experience may also be considered. The role requires an on-site presence in Nanuet, NY, along with a reliable, professional, and collaborative approach.
